## Data Stores — Telemetry Compression (Skylark Ingest)

Welcome aboard! Quick orientation: raw telemetry payloads from the Skylark fleet get zstd-compressed at the edge before they ever hit our ingest tier. The compression dictionary is versioned and lives in the metadata store, so if you bump the dictionary you must write a new row there — never overwrite. Decompression stats land in the same store for dashboarding. To poke at the metadata store locally, use the connection string below.

replica DSN, kajep-yahag: mssql://praok_svc:iF@db-8d68.plorvaio.local:5432/eliion

Changelog — PulsePatch v2.4.0. Heads up, reviewers: we renamed FW_CHAN_KEY to UPDATE_CHANNEL_SECRET because nobody could remember what "chan" meant and it kept getting confused with the channel name setting. The old name still works for one release but logs a deprecation warning. Update your local .env files accordingly; the renamed variable should appear right after this note.

vault entry, yahif-yajep: COURIER_KEY29=b802bdf8034096b65a51c6ba5abe2

During a routine audit of the Hallwren museum audio-guide backend, we found the production instance diverging from the approved baseline. TLS minimum version was lowered, session timeout extended to twelve hours, and the content-CDN allowlist contains two unrecognized entries. We cannot determine when these changes landed; deploy logs show no matching release. Please assess exposure before we reconcile. For reference, the live values currently in effect are reproduced below.

config for yajep-tafof:
[rusath]
team = julmir
access_code = ac_fe37fd
host = rusath.novactech.test
port = 8000
owner = pelmir.weneth
peer = oliwyn.olvarqdyn.internal

Attendees: operations, finance, and product leads of Corvane Industries. The meeting reviewed the proposed 900K budget request for expanding the Tidewell assembly line. Finance confirmed available reserves; operations flagged a twelve-week equipment lead time. Product raised concerns about demand assumptions and asked for revised forecasts before submission. It was agreed the request will go to the executive committee next month with updated figures. The confidential strategic context behind this request is recorded below.

board note of tawip-hahip: Only 7 of the 80 pilot accounts renewed Ralath, so a churn review is set for April 1.